But what exactly is it, particularly? After we talk about carbon capture and storage, we consult with a set of systems that intention to capture CO2 emitted by industrial plants or electricity vegetation and store it permanently underground, Using the prospective to utilize it in certain industrial processes also. The key goal of these systems, in any case, is to circumvent CO2 from coming into the atmosphere.
The seize and storage course of action occurs in a few major phases. The primary is linked to the particular capture, specifically The instant if the CO2 is separated within the exhaust gases. While in the transportation stage, CO2 is compressed and transported as a result of Exclusive ducts to become injected into deep geological formations, which include porous rocks or former pure useful resource deposits. This final move is the particular storage.
In carbon capture programs, seize systems can be diverse. The procedures can start right after combustion, with the removal in get more info the CO2 immediately after the particular combustion of your gasoline or perhaps just before. From the latter scenario, the gas is reworked right into a gasoline rich in hydrogen and CO2. An additional approach is connected with oxy-gas combustion, through which combustion occurs making use of pure oxygen.

Among the advantages, the most obvious is usually that CCS technologies can drastically reduce industrial emissions and those who come from numerous vegetation. Another advantage of an infrastructural nature is the potential of putting in CCS devices within present crops, eliminating the need For brand spanking new infrastructure investment decision.
On top of that, During this particular historic period, CCS may well characterize on the list of couple certainly productive choices for attaining decarbonization objectives in the sectors described as challenging-to-abate, which is, all those that manage to resist the ongoing improve much more than Some others, including cement factories, metal mills, or refineries.
Then again, the feasible constraints of these technologies worry, over all, The prices, which happen to be however pretty substantial for the construction and routine maintenance with the plants, and also the substantial portions of energy needed to accomplish the process.
Another very intriguing aspect with regards to CCS systems considerations their doable integration read more with other modern day Strength units, such as all These involving renewable Electricity. To begin with, it needs to be clarified that CCS does not symbolize a substitute for renewables in any way but a perhaps complementary Remedy to Vitality infrastructures depending on thoroughly clean resources.
The two units could collaborate correctly in cutting down residual emissions in industrial sectors, notably for some slicing-edge projects focused on bioenergy and seize techniques, in addition to for that production of blue hydrogen, wherever CO2 linked to methane can be captured.

FAQs
What on earth is Carbon Capture and Storage (CCS)?
Carbon Capture and Storage (CCS) is a technology designed to reduce get more info CO₂ emissions from industrial procedures and electrical power generation. It really works by capturing carbon dioxide on the source, transporting it, after which you can storing it deep underground in geological formations to read more forestall it from getting into the ambiance.
How can CCS work?
The method is split into three most important stages:
Seize: CO₂ is divided from other gases on the emission resource.
Transport: The captured gasoline is compressed and moved by using pipelines or ships.
Storage: CO₂ is injected into deep underground rock formations, for example depleted oil fields or saline aquifers.
Which industries benefit probably the most from CCS?
CCS is particularly effective in sectors that happen to be difficult to decarbonise, like:
Cement production
Steel manufacturing
Chemical processing
Normal gasoline and coal ability vegetation
What exactly are some great benefits of CCS?
Significant emission reductions in large-output sectors
Integration with existing infrastructure
Supports the production of reduced-carbon hydrogen
Can complement renewable Vitality through intermittency
What exactly are the constraints of CCS?
Substantial expenditures for installation and upkeep
Electricity-intensive seize and storage process
Requires careful site checking to avoid leaks
Is CCS a replacement for renewable energy?
No, CCS is not a substitute for renewables. It’s a complementary know-how that could function together with wind, solar, and other clean up Vitality solutions to lessen All round emissions.
Can CCS assistance obtain international weather goals?
Indeed. When coupled with other systems like renewables and hydrogen, CCS can play an important job in lowering world wide emissions and Conference lengthy-phrase local climate targets.
